1200 is enough if you don't include a huge display.
 
Lets see if we can get you started at least...

$225 - MSI 8800GTS 512MB
$225 - Intel Q6600
$110 - MSI P35 Neo2-FR
$110 - WD6400AAKS
$90 - Corsair HX520W
$70 - 4GB DDR2-800 2x2GB
$50 - Some Cooler Master case
$40 - Xigmatek HDT-S1283
$27 - Samsung SH-S203B
============
$950 + tax and shipping (before rebates)

Does he need an OS?
What monitor will he be using?
What games does he play and at what resolution/settings?
What else is included in that $1200 budget?
